Output 17426515f2c125cc87cb3a0e5251449f3f4bea21aa5651c600fc70fb634519bc:0

value
107853957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 137483938e6261fcede790f96ca30fa8e3ce5626 OP_EQUALVERIFY OP_CHECKSIG
address
D6uxxSEGp1pX6BiMUZYXXyUZsyGVL9YEHS
transaction
17426515f2c125cc87cb3a0e5251449f3f4bea21aa5651c600fc70fb634519bc